In any case, it is now not the case that a business can register a domain name. Get this. Businesses are NOT ALLOWED to own .CN domain names. ONLY INDIVIDUALS. I’ll let you all ponder why that may be the case. It is about as hard as figuring out why BBQ’s attract flies.
